THE HOUSE
This spacious and stunning late 1930’s. A sensitive renovation has retained all of the character of the original house & melded it with modern luxury.

-natural lights fills the house
-views from every window, Hobart, the mountain, the river & the house gardens
-a peaceful garden
-watch the native wildlife (birds, pademelons) from one of the two living areas
-built for the Chief Engineer of the Cascade Brewery and his family, it is named after him; “Bowen Toft House”
-some furniture in the house was built by the original owner
-3rd generation family-owned home

ENVIRONMENTAL CONSIDERATIONS:
The interior has been designed by Nance to provide carefully curated rooms using new, vintage, and family furniture and décor. The house retains its original features.
-the house was renovated with minimal waste (we even recycled the old tiles for craft use at the local tip)
-we promote recycling & reuse & there are receptacles in the house for recycling
-the house is fully electric, even the BBQ, to help look after our environment
-solar power will be installed in the future

PILLOWS:
We've changed the way we have bed pillows, as we were washing lots of pillowcases for pillows not used. We are always looking at ways to reduce the environmental impact.
There is 1x pillowcase in each spot on the beds & then if you want extras, we have 2 spare in the master wardrobe in bags plus we have a pillow menu of 9 pillows in the cane baskets in the twin single room. So, there are heaps of extra pillows & feel free to use them.
If you use the extra pillows, please leave them out with their cases & ribbons so we know to change them. We believe you can have all the home comforts & still save on waste.
